Output deb4c006f89e5b679e49754226af9d4e2fa823d010db9f4e27c964f5ebf3f240:0

value
31608864
script pubkey
OP_0 OP_PUSHBYTES_20 e4481c83a40b4d30f69d4fe7ce38e3d00752edcb
address
bc1qu3ypeqaypdxnpa5aflnuuw8r6qr49mwtn7529s
transaction
deb4c006f89e5b679e49754226af9d4e2fa823d010db9f4e27c964f5ebf3f240
confirmations
265554
spent
true